Product Overview: Maxim Integrated MAX5352AEUA+T
The MAX5352AEUA+T is a high-performance, low-power, 10-bit digital-to-analog converter (DAC) from Maxim Integrated, designed to deliver precision analog output in a compact package. This device is particularly suitable for applications requiring a small footprint and minimal power consumption without compromising on accuracy or output quality.
Key Features
- Resolution: The MAX5352AEUA+T offers a 10-bit resolution, providing fine granularity for analog output signals.
- Power Efficiency: With its low-power consumption, this DAC is ideal for battery-powered devices and power-sensitive applications.
- Voltage Reference: An internal precision voltage reference ensures stable performance and reduces the need for external components.
- Package: Housed in a space-saving 8-pin µMAX package, the MAX5352AEUA+T is designed for compact PCB layouts.
- Interface: The device features a simple 3-wire serial interface that supports SPI, QSPI, and MICROWIRE protocols, allowing for easy integration into a variety of systems.
- Supply Range: It operates from a single +2.7V to +5.5V power supply, accommodating a wide range of applications.
- Temperature Range: The MAX5352AEUA+T is specified over the extended -40°C to +85°C temperature range, making it reliable in diverse operating conditions.
